Root Cause
A secondary node in a replica set experienced a rollback because it applied writes that were later overwritten by the primary.

80% success Check the rollback data in the rollback/ directory on the affected node and manually restore any necessary documents using mongorestore.

85% success Ensure all secondary nodes have caught up with the primary by monitoring replication lag and increasing oplog size if needed.

75% success Set writeConcern to majority to reduce the chance of rollbacks by ensuring writes are acknowledged by a majority of nodes.

Dead Ends
Common approaches that don't work:
-
50% fail
Ignoring the rollback and continuing operations can cause data inconsistency between nodes.
-
50% fail
Manually forcing the secondary to become primary without resolving the rollback can cause data loss.
-
50% fail
Decreasing the oplog size to save disk space increases the likelihood of future rollbacks.
